The general way to make eggs over easy is to start with some oil and a clean frying pan. The best type of oil that should be used with this recipe would be some canola oil since it would typical not add any oily taste to the meal. Some canola oil can be added to the frying pan, the oil should be enough to cover the whole pan.

Keep the heat below the pan at a medium level to avoid burning the eggs while cooking. Crack the egg, being careful to keep the yolk intact, and gently pour into the pan. Add as many eggs as necessary in relation to the number of people being served.

It is important for cooks to avoid placing too many eggs into the pan at one time or else the yolks will eventually start to break. Just place one or two into a bowl and then dump these directly into the pan. Once the eggs have been placed in the pan, simply wait for about two minutes while they cook.

The hotter the pan is, the quicker the egg will begin to solidify. Personal preference will dictate how firm the egg white and egg yolk should be. At the very least, the egg needs to be firm enough to withstand the turning over stage without falling to pieces.

The hardest part with eggs over easy is with the flipping of the eggs in the pan, since this is usually where most people will generally break up their eggs' yolks. The best way to flip the eggs in the pan will be with the use of a big spatula. This should be done very slowly and carefully too in order to avoid breaking the yolks of the eggs.

The final step, after turning the eggs, is to lower the heat if necessary. This part of the process will determine whether the eggs will have a soft, or a firm, center. Each person has a different preference. Keep a close eye on the texture of the yolk, and remove the pan from the heat when the preferred consistency is reached. Transfer the eggs to a platter and enjoy.
